Ansley got her ventilator out!!!

Praise God!! Ansley has had her ventilator out for over 24 hours now!! She got it removed yesterday, June 14, at 4pm. The doctors try to ween preemies between 7 and 10 days, they say the longer they have it in, the harder it is to ween them. She has a nasal canula connected to a CPAP machine and is still on 21% room air. She is breathing a little faster, because she is having to work harder breathing on her own. Her blood gases have been fine since they took her off the vent. There is a possibility that they may have to put it back in, if her blood gases come back abnormal. (so far so good!!) They are still having to use the bilirubin lights (just one) to regulate her bilirubin levels. Her feedings are going well, she is still receiving 2cc's every 6 hours via orogastric feeding tube.
